Philly.NET Center City User Group Forming

The Philly.NET community has been very strong, thanks in part to the dedication of Bill Wolff and others who have led that group for the past five years.  While always popular, sometimes it can be hard for folks from center city or south Jersey to make the trek out to Malvern, Pa. in the western suburbs.

So now, some great news for folks who work or live in Center City Philadelphia.  With Bill's help, and under the leadership of Danilo Diaz, Philly.NET is spreading its wings by starting up a new sister group downtown!  The first Center City meeting will take place on February 28th.  Here are the details:

Topic: LINQ

How many times have you wished you had SQL like language for querying your in memory data structures?  Microsoft Visual Studio Code Name “Orcas” Language-Integrated Query or LINQ is a new feature of C# 3.0 that supports "a set of features such as lambdas, extension methods, and query comprehensions that enable compilers to understand and implement query logic over in-memory collections of objects." according to the LINQ FAQ. So what does that mean, well basically it is a language that lets you query in memory data structures like collections, XML, etc more easily. I will introduce you to LINQ and then take you on an in depth look at LINQ and its uses in this presentation.
